Output d3fb4dee3820dd13d38a6895c6f7f4acc7ecd52c0cc4329848d60680e4978313:0

value
78630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85c6c2f3400ba92b08159dc5afb0a14cd92ae655 OP_EQUAL
address
3DtMuFTHeWtaFeue6KtDiMdHcDagURgHLK
transaction
d3fb4dee3820dd13d38a6895c6f7f4acc7ecd52c0cc4329848d60680e4978313
spent
true